The Part Time course in MBA is a 3-year programme, with specialization in either Marketing, Human Resource Management or Finance. It is a modular programme wherein students become eligible for a certificate, a diploma and finally a degree after the completion of one, two and three years respectively. The applicant should be a Graduate in any discipline with a minimum working experience of two years at a supervisory level in any organization. Self employed persons having the above-mentioned qualification and experience may also apply. Total number of seats is 20. Course fee is Rs. 20,000/- per year.
Candidates have to appear in a Written Test to be conducted by CMS-DU. Candidates who qualify in the Written Test will be selected on the basis of their performance in the test and industry experience.
The course structure is tabulated below:
Year 1 10100 Business Environment 10200 Principles of Management 10300 Human Resource Management 10400 Managerial Economics 10500 Accounting for Managers 10600 Marketing Management 10700 Financial Management 10800 Quantitative Techniques
Year 2 20100 Organisational Behaviour 20200 Business and Labour Laws 20300 Business Policy and Strategic Analysis 20400 Research Methodology 20500 International Business 20600 Computer Application and Data Processing 20700 Ethos and Values for Managers 20800 Production and Operations Management
Year 3 30100 Management Information System 30200 Project Work 303X0 Specialization I 304X0 Specialization II 305X0 Specialization III 306X0 Specialization IV 307X0 Specialization V 308X0 Specialization VI The specialization groups and the related courses are tabulated below:
Marketing Management 30310 Consumer Behaviour 30410 Advertising and Brand Management 30510 Marketing of Services and Rural Marketing 30610 International Marketing 30710 Sales and Distribution Management 30810 Strategic Marketing
Human Resource Management 30320 Management of Industrial Relations 30420 Legal Framework Governing Industrial Relations 30520 HRD Strategies and Systems 30620 Compensation Management 30720 Cross Cultural and Global Human Resource Management 30820 Organisational Change and Intervention Strategies
Financial Management 30330 Financial Decision Analysis 30430 Security Analysis, Investment and Portfolio Management 30530 International Financial Management 30630 Management of Financial Services 30730 Corporate Taxation 30830 Working Capital Management Each course has an internal assessment of 40 marks and an end year examination of 60 marks. Course 30200 being entirely based on a project study has no end year examinations; as such the internal component is of 100 marks for the said course. The internal assessment is done through sessionals, presentations, assignments, attendance, practicals and /or projects depending on the nature of the course. A student must attend at least 50% of classes in each course to be able to appear in the end year examination as a regular candidate. Those with less than 50% attendance are debarred from appearing in their end year examinations (except under exceptional circumstances at the discretion of the Centre).
Students must score 40% for being declared pass in a course and an aggregate of 45% to pass a year.
